Mourinho plans to rescue unhappy Man Utd striker Ronaldo

Roma are in contact with Manchester United striker Cristiano Ronaldo.

According to The Sun, Paris St Germain, Bayern Munich and Roma, who are led by the star’s former Real Madrid boss Jose Mourinho, have expressed an interest in the striker.

His agent Jorge Mendes held talks with new Old Trafford supremo Richard Arnold over concerns about his team’s poor form.

They were knocked out of the FA Cup by Middlesbrough and are in a real fight for fourth place in the Premier League after disappointing draws with Burnley and Southampton.

The ex-Real Madrid man is also struggling and will be looking to end his longest goal drought in more than a decade when United host Brighton this evening.

Ronaldo is understood to only wish to stay if United qualify for next season’s Champions League.

He also has concerns over the attitude of some of his team-mates amid their recent struggles.
